
APV Benefit featuring Stephan Said
June 13, 2012
Internationally acclaimed recording artist and activist Stephan Said, known for his role in the Arab Spring and Occupy, as well as the Seattle WTO and global antiwar movements, will be playing at the Camel on Saturday, June 16 to play a benefit concert for the Alliance for Progressive Values, a volunteer, not for profit organization, whose goal is to educate and influence the public, the media and elected officials at the local, state and national levels about important issues of the day.
